Output 22ec9acd4a83e1dbaac61e2dd5ce4667fb2bea2d9c674866bc32c56cb5741260:1

value
99618633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b4f23860725559c52c64877979d2f0db70aa076 OP_EQUAL
address
3FrDTwCCNUF8y5SPiePUDGEmqs8FBnXHHZ
transaction
22ec9acd4a83e1dbaac61e2dd5ce4667fb2bea2d9c674866bc32c56cb5741260
confirmations
271743
spent
true